Clemmie Stewart Director of Learning & Teaching & vice chair of governors, with 14 years of experience in the education sector, she is responsible for supporting schools in the UK and abroad. She also promotes educational staff to teach and lead with confidence.
Dr Emma Kell has nearly 25 years as a teacher and school leader and currently teaches in Alternative Provision as well as working as a writer, speaker, governor, wellbeing trainer and coach.
Discuss their new book, the guidance they give leaders, and Clemmie's experience on the Senior Leadership Programme.

Their book "A Little Guide for Teachers: Engaging Parents and Carers with School" can be found here: https://www.amazon.co.uk/Little-Guide-Teachers-Engaging-Parents/dp/1529796326
